CHAR vs VARCHAR issues can be resolved only through proper planning. … WebDec 16, 2024 · A common misconception is to think that with nchar (n) and nvarchar (n), the n defines the number of characters. However, in nchar (n) and nvarchar (n), the n defines the string length in byte-pairs (0-4,000). n never defines numbers of characters that can be stored. WebOct 7, 2024 · First, CHAR and VARCHAR: CHAR is a fixed-length column with a maximum length of 255 characters. You declare the size when you create the table. If you store fewer characters than the fixed length, MySQL pads the remainder with spaces. Therefore, CHAR always consumes the same amount of storage.
